Output 50b617665f508f2191fdbef0b0bf3c4c0ad7214bfd99e5a65c4c1a28fc39a7e1:1

value
190662
script pubkey
OP_0 OP_PUSHBYTES_20 3b18a5d858738c850aecfa1a608dbbcc5a23da50
address
bc1q8vv2tkzcwwxg2zhvlgdxprdme3dz8kjs739lhh
transaction
50b617665f508f2191fdbef0b0bf3c4c0ad7214bfd99e5a65c4c1a28fc39a7e1
spent
true